The Alabama Crimson Tide finished with a 9-3 record during the 2024 college football regular season. Alabama just missed out on the college football playoffs, and it will be interesting to see what head coach Kalen DeBoer does during his second season with the program.

The Crimson Tide will have a brutal schedule in SEC Conference play. Alabama is looking to get back to the postseason. There could be some potential consequences for this football program if they were to miss the college football playoffs for the second consecutive season.
College Football Analyst Reveals Potential Worst-Case Scenario For the Alabama Crimson Tide

Brad Crawford of CBS Sports believes the best-case scenario for Alabama for the 2025 season is for them to finish with a 12-0 record during the regular season. However, he feels as if the worst-case scenario for Alabama will be them finishing with an 8-4 record. There is a world that could feel very realistic for this football program.
“All hell will break loose among Alabama supporters if the Crimson Tide stub their toe against Florida State or Wisconsin before opening SEC play at Georgia on Sept. 27. The Seminoles have a new offense under Gus Malzahn and the Badgers are struggling to find footing with Luke Fickell in charge. Even with those games out of the way, Alabama has six matchups with teams inside CBS Sports’ post-spring top 25 rankings. We’re setting the floor at eight wins. If DeBoer gets Alabama to the playoff, this team will have earned it.”
It would be hard for Alabama to slip up against Wisconsin or Florida State before conference play. It wouldn’t be a surprise to see the Crimson Tide lose to the Georgia Bulldogs and the South Carolina Gamecocks on the road in 2025. They didn’t beat the Tennessee Volunteers on the road in 2024, but it would be surprising if the Crimson Tide lost to Tennessee this time around.
Another potential loss on the Crimson Tide schedule could be against the LSU Tigers. They host the Tigers, but LSU will look to embarrass Alabama on the road. The Crimson Tide absolutely dismantled the Tigers in 2024. A lot could be riding on the college football playoff in that game as well. Alabama missing the playoffs once again could out DeBoer on the hot seat entering the 2026 college football season.
